👀 Terrence Howard Alleges Diddy Tried To Come On To Him
Whew, Terrence Howard just dropped a bombshell, and social media is buzzing.
During a sit-down on the PBD Podcast, the Hustle & Flow star claimed that Sean “Diddy” Combs repeatedly invited him over to coach him on acting—but according to Howard, things quickly got… weird.
“Puffy invited me, for weeks, asking me to come teach him how to—wanted me to be his acting coach for a while,” Terrence shared.
But when he showed up to help, he says Diddy wasn’t trying to act—he was just sitting and staring at him.
🎵 Music Sessions Turned Awkward?
Terrence said that after a few visits, he tried to switch gears by playing some of his music.
But even then, Diddy allegedly just sat there, saying nothing.
Confused and uncomfortable, Terrence asked his assistant what was going on.
The assistant allegedly told him:
“‘I think he’s trying to f–k you.’”
And that was it. Terrence said he cut ties with Diddy right then and there.

⚖️ Diddy’s Legal Storm Isn’t Slowing Down
Terrence Howard’s claim is just the latest in a growing mountain of troubling accusations surrounding Diddy, who is currently under federal investigation for sex trafficking and facing multiple lawsuits involving alleged sexual abuse.
Earlier this year, a man named Joseph Manzaro filed a lawsuit claiming the “I Need a Girl” rapper not only facilitated trafficking but directly committed acts of sexual violence in 2015.
And while some celebs like Nick Cannon have denied participating in Diddy’s alleged “Freak-Off” parties—and others, like Justin Bieber, have distanced themselves from the mogul—Terrence Howard is the first major star to accuse Diddy of making an actual pass at him.
🔙 Let’s Not Forget The ‘Empire’ Drama
This also isn’t the first time Diddy and Terrence Howard’s paths have crossed with tension.
Back in 2014, sources claimed Diddy blocked his stepson Quincy Brown from appearing on “Empire“—which, of course, starred Howard—because he didn’t want Quincy signing over his music rights.
“Diddy kicked up a huge stink and called all the top brass at 20th Century Fox TV,” one insider told Page Six.
While it’s unclear if that had anything to do with their personal dynamic, it definitely adds a little more smoke to this fire.
